A website audit for locksmiths reviews the urgency, coverage, and trust signals customers rely on when locked out: emergency and click-to-call paths, service-area content, licensing and identity context, consistent local business details, review references, and mobile-related markup. Locksmiths are usually found by people who need help now, so an audit for locksmiths leads with the essentials of a local service search: obvious contact and click-to-call paths, clear service areas, and consistent business details that a search engine and a customer can both trust.
